~~~~~~~~~ PLEASE PAY ATTENTION: THIS IS THE TRANSLATION IN DUTCH ONLY OF THE KAROO PATTERN~~~~~~~~~ Welcome to the Karoo Vintage Mystery - A - Long! Every two weeks a new part of this SloCro Crochet A Long will be released, until Karoo will be a blanket of about 65"x 65". If you are reading this text in English, you are probably looking for the English pattern. That can be found here: https://www.ravelry.com/patterns/library/karoo-vintage-mal Part One is called "Darling" inspired by an actual village in South Africa. The aim is to work this project in parts, each inspired by Jen Tyler's favourite quaint and interesting villages in The Karoo. You can read all about Darling and The Karoo on her blog: https://hooksntales.blogspot.com/ This project is a SloCro ( Slow Crochet ) so the idea is to do it in your own time. I will be releasing each part every 2-weeks and you can follow along, or wait until the end to begin. No pressure, just pure take-it-easy and enjoy! Make an antique-inspired crochet basket with this free crochet pattern. Stiffen the basket once it's made to give it a more sturdy look. This intermediate crochet pattern is ideal for flower girls to use at weddings, or kids to use at Easter to carry their candy. White crochet thread is used to complete this basket. Handles make it easy for kids of all ages to carry. The look of this basket can be personalized a bit by adding an applique such as a flower or butterfly.
